Thank you for showing an interest in the University of the Third Age (Pyrénées Orientales). The U3A (PO) has evolved into a successful, and I hope, happy mix of English-speaking residents of this lovely area of France.

Our membership comprises many nationalities, with both full and part time residents.

We continue to keep the structure as simple as possible. Our Committee oversees and guides those who are the real backbone of the U3A(PO) – the group co-ordinators and facilitators, who ensure that the groups are run efficiently and pleasurably while still upholding the objectives and principles of our U3A, which are:

  1. To advance the cultural and educational interests of its members.
  2. To provide leisure and recreational activities in order to improve the conditions of life and social welfare of its members.

Our U3A is non-profit making and self-funding. We have an annual membership fee of 10 Euros per person, 20 Euros per couple. On joining it is 15 Euros which includes a 5 Euro administration fee. The membership year runs from 1 June to 31 May. The membership fee is non-refundable. This pays for the running costs of the U3A.
